How To Fix IU530 - No tables selected for initialization


IU530 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: IU - Incremental Conversion (ICNV)

  • Message number: 530

  • Message text: No tables selected for initialization

    The SAP error message IU530 "No tables selected for initialization" typically occurs during the initialization process of the SAP system, particularly when working with the SAP IS-U (Industry Solution for Utilities) module. This error indicates that the system did not find any tables that need to be initialized for the specific process you are trying to execute.
    Causes:
    
    Incorrect Selection Criteria: The selection criteria for the initialization process may not match any existing tables. This can happen if the filters or parameters set for the initialization are too restrictive.
    Missing Configuration: The necessary configuration for the initialization process may not have been completed. This could include missing settings in the customizing or configuration tables.
    Data Model Changes: If there have been changes to the data model (e.g., new tables added or existing tables modified), the initialization process may not recognize the tables that need to be initialized.
